Jodie Foster: Was Brad Pitt's F1 AI-Generated?

At the Aspen Ideas Festival, Oscar-winning actress Jodie Foster speculated that the 2025 film F1, which stars Brad Pitt, may have utilized artificial intelligence in its creation. Foster commented on the movie's narrative structure and dialogue, suggesting they bore the hallmarks of computer-generated content. She stated this observation was not a criticism, given the film's significant financial success.

Foster further discussed AI's impact on Hollywood, acknowledging its role in job displacement. However, she also highlighted its potential for specific applications, such as aiding in pre-visualization and storyboarding during the early stages of film production. She mentioned her recent film, A Private Life, featured a successful AI-assisted dream sequence.

She concluded by expressing a desire for filmmakers to maintain control over AI technology. Foster believes that by mastering AI, creators can produce work that authentically reflects humanity and leads to improvements in filmmaking. Representatives for F1 have not yet responded to Foster's remarks.
